Le rappel stimulé pour mieux comprendre les stratégies de lecture d'élèves du primaire à risque et compétents

Abstract
Cet article decrit de quelle facon la methode du rappel stimule, utilisee apres une tâche de comprehension d’un texte informatif, amene une meilleure connaissance des strategies de lecture de trois eleves de sixieme annee ayant des portraits de lecteur differents. Les explicitations et commentaires rappeles de ces eleves portant sur leurs actions et pensees permettent de degager leurs procedures pour comprendre un texte, en utilisant ou non des strategies efficaces, qui elles-memes se referent a des connaissances differentes. Les contributions et les limites du rappel stimule utilisees aupres d’eleves sont discutees. Abstract This article describes how a stimulated recall method used after a reading comprehension task contributes to a better understanding of the strategies employed by three different Grade 6 readers. After reading an informative text, the students explained and commented on their own actions and thoughts, exposing how they proceeded to understand their reading and whether or not they used strategies based on multiple knowledge types. Contributions and limits of the stimulated recall method for students are discussed.
